LARP6 regulates the mRNA translation of fibrogenic genes in liver fibrosis
2025-01-18
Abstract excerpt
<h4>Summary</h4> Metabolic syndrome and excessive alcohol consumption result in liver injury and fibrosis, which is characterized by increased collagen production by activated Hepatic Stellate Cells (HSCs). LARP6, an RNA-binding protein, was shown to facilitate collagen production.
